This flanker shares zero DNA with the original Amarige, so don't be fooled by the name. It's a divisive scent, some find it a gorgeous, clean scent reminiscent of fresh sweet peas, while others recoil from its sharp, sour opening. You'll either love it or hate it, so sample first.
No.029 delivers a fun, faithful green-apple-and-cucumber opening in line with DKNY Be Delicious, but the floral heart and woody base thin out much sooner than the original's crisp, long-wearing drydown - a cheerful everyday casual option.

Occasions
Its moderate sillage and 'light and airy' character make it suitable for office wear and casual outings without being overpowering. The overall clean, floral nature lends itself well to daytime use, but isn't quite bold or formal enough for grand events.
